Understanding Migration Lag and Its Implications
One of the significant challenges during an enterprise migration is migration lag, a phenomenon where your traffic might dip as search engines take time to reindex your new site. For businesses like yours, this lag can last for months, potentially affecting client acquisition and retention. Therefore, it's vital to employ a robust redirect strategy, prioritizing high-traffic pages to limit your visibility loss during this period.
Enhancing Your Redirect Strategy: Key Steps
A successful migration involves a keen focus on the processes of redirecting URLs efficiently. Start by identifying the pages that drive the most traffic or revenue, ensuring they redirect accurately to their new addresses. This may include:
- Utilizing wildcards for categories of pages, such as redirecting all products to a centralized hub.
- Moving any existing URL parameters correctly to maintain user experience.
- Resolving redirect chains to ensure that your visitors are always reaching the intended pages without unnecessary hops.
Additionally, check for backlinks pointing to old pages and ensure they are redirected appropriately to preserve any SEO benefits you’ve accumulated.
Special Insights for MedSpas: The Soft-Launch Technique
Recent discussions around soft-launching a new domain before the official migration have emerged, suggesting that allowing search engines to index a new domain early can reduce migration lag. For instance, you might consider testing this strategy by launching a new version of your site early and monitoring how quickly it is indexed in Google Search Console. This could lead to heightened visibility sooner, crucial as client inquiries drive your business.
